Conversion Formula
µC/cm = pC/m × 1.000000000e-8
About Picocoulombs per metre
The picocoulomb per metre (pC/m) equals 10⁻¹² C/m, the scale for charge induced on carbon nanotubes by gate electrodes and for lightly charged polymer chains. A metallic single-wall carbon nanotube at a gate bias of a few volts carries about 10-100 pC/m; weakly charged polyelectrolytes in high-salt solution have effective linear charge densities of 1-100 pC/m after ion condensation. 1 pC/m = 10⁻¹² C/m = 10⁻³ nC/m.
About Microcoulombs per centimetre
The microcoulomb per centimetre (µC/cm) equals exactly 10⁻⁴ C/m, used in electrophoresis and charged-particle beam physics. Charged particle beams in linear accelerators are characterised by bunch charge per unit beam length; a 1 nC electron bunch compressed to 1 mm gives 1 µC/cm = 0.1 mC/m; ion implant beam line charge densities are quoted in µC/cm for process uniformity. 1 µC/cm = 10⁻⁴ C/m = 0.1 mC/m.
